立即上架APP

提供从软著申请,应用商店资质账号申请协助,到APP预审,APP截图优化,APP排名优化,APP审核加急,APP被拒修改,APP版本更新全业务流服务

覆盖苹果APPstore、谷歌play、华为、小米、魅族、OPPO、VIVO、百度、360、应用宝等30+目标商店

一门深耕APP生态服务,郑重承诺:app没上架成功,上架服务费全额退款!


如何查询苹果上架注册信息

在App Store上发布应用程序是一个相对简单的过程,但是有时候我们需要查询特定应用程序的注册信息,比如开发者信息、应用程序的版本号、上架时间等。本文将为您介绍如何查询苹果上架注册信息的原理及详细步骤。

一、原理

在苹果公司开发者中心,开发者可以注册并创建自己的应用程序。在应用程序上架之前,苹果公司会审核应用程序并生成一些元数据,比如应用程序的版本号、上架时间、开发者信息等。这些元数据存储在苹果公司的服务器上,并可以通过API接口来查询。

二、查询步骤

1. 首先,我们需要获取目标应用程序的Bundle ID。Bundle ID是应用程序的唯一标识符,可以在应用程序的Info.plist文件中找到。如果您不知道应用程序的Bundle ID,可以在App Store中搜索应用程序并复制其URL,URL中的字符串就是应用程序的Bundle ID。

2. 接下来,我们需要使用苹果提供的iTunes API来查询应用程序的注册信息。iTunes API是苹果公司提供的一组API接口,可以查询App Store上的应用程序信息。具体来说,我们需要使用以下API接口:

https://itunes.apple.com/lookup?id=Bundle-ID

其中,Bundle-ID是我们获取到的目标应用程序的Bundle ID。例如,如果我们想要查询微信应用程序的注册信息,我们需要使用以下API接口:

https://itunes.apple.com/lookup?id=com.tencent.xin

3. 发送HTTP请求并解析响应。我们可以使用任何一种编程语言发送HTTP请求并解析响应,比如Python、Java、C#等。以下是一个Python示例代码:

```python

import requests

import json

bundle_id = "com.tencent.xin"

url = f"https://itunes.apple.com/lookup?id={bundle_id}"

response = requests.get(url)

data = json.loads(response.text)

```

4. 解析响应数据。查询结果是一个JSON格式的字符串,我们需要解析这个字符串并提取我们需要的信息。以下是一个Python示例代码:

```python

app = data['results'][0]

app_name = app['trackName']

app_version = app['version']

app_release_date = app['currentVersionReleaseDate']

developer_name = app['sellerName']

```

通过以上步骤,我们就可以查询目标应用程序的注册信息了。具体来说,我们可以获取应用程序的名称、版本号、上架时间、开发者名称等信息。

总之,通过使用苹果提供的iTunes API,我们可以轻松地查询任何一个应用程序的注册信息。这项功能对于开发者和研究人员来说非常有用,可以帮助他们更好地了解应用程序的开发和上架过程。


相关知识:
ios开发真机调试与app上架
iOS开发真机调试与App上架全流程详解 作为iOS开发者,真机调试和App上架是必须掌握的核心技能。本文将为您详细介绍iOS开发从真机调试到App Store上架的全流程,帮助开发者顺利完成应用发布。 真机调试的必要准备 Apple开发者账号 需要注册
2025-09-01
如何上架一款app
如何成功上架一款APP:从开发到发布的完整指南 在移动互联网时代,APP已成为企业和个人连接用户的重要渠道。然而,许多开发者在完成APP开发后,往往在上架环节遇到各种问题。本文将详细介绍如何顺利将您的APP上架到各大应用商店。 第一步:前期准备工作 确定
2025-09-01
app上架没有公司资质怎么办
APP上架没有公司资质怎么办?解决方法全解析 在当今移动互联网时代,APP开发已成为创业的热门选择。然而,许多独立开发者和小团队在APP开发完成后,常常面临一个头疼的问题:没有公司资质如何上架应用商店? 为什么应用商店需要公司资质? 无论是苹果App St
2025-09-01
ios工具类app容易上架吗
iOS工具类APP上架全攻略:如何提高审核通过率? 在移动应用开发领域,iOS平台因其优质用户群体和良好的商业生态而备受开发者青睐。其中,工具类APP因其实用性强、用户需求明确而成为热门开发方向。但很多开发者都面临一个共同问题:iOS工具类APP容易上架吗
2025-09-01
app不上架能在手机上运行吗
APP不上架能在手机上运行吗?答案是肯定的! 在移动互联网时代,越来越多的企业和个人开始开发属于自己的APP。然而,很多开发者都会面临一个疑问:APP不上架应用商店,是否可以在手机上直接运行? 答案是肯定的——即使不通过苹果App Store或谷歌Play
2025-06-25
安卓app上架app
安卓应用程序(APP)上架是指将开发完成的应用程序上传至Google Play商店,以供用户下载和使用。下面将详细介绍安卓APP上架的原理和步骤。一、上架原理安卓APP上架的原理主要是通过Google Play商店进行实现。Google Play商店是一款
2023-04-17
app怎么上架苹果商城
在移动互联网时代,App已经成为人们日常生活中不可或缺的一部分。而苹果商城(App Store)则是iOS设备用户获取App的主要途径之一。那么,作为一个开发者,如何将自己开发的App上传到苹果商城呢?下面就来介绍一下上架苹果商城的原理和详细步骤。## 上
2023-04-17
apicloudapp上架苹果
APICloud是一款移动应用开发平台,可以让开发者使用HTML、CSS、JavaScript等前端技术快速开发出移动应用。在开发完成后,开发者需要将应用上架到各个应用商店中,以便用户下载使用。本文将详细介绍如何将APICloud开发的应用上架到苹果应用商
2023-04-17
混合开发app上架谷歌
混合开发是指在一个应用中同时使用了原生开发和web开发技术,通常情况下,我们使用webview来实现web部分的功能,而原生部分则使用Android或iOS的开发技术来实现。相比于原生开发,混合开发可以更快速地开发出app,同时也可以更快速地更新和维护ap
2023-04-17
app已重新上架
在移动应用市场中,有些应用会因为各种原因被下架,比如违反了规定、存在安全隐患等等。但是,如果这些应用做出了相应的改进,就可以重新提交审核并重新上架。那么,重新上架的原理是什么呢?下面就来详细介绍一下。首先,需要明确的是,重新上架的前提条件是应用已经被下架。
2023-04-17
app上架华为应用市场需要什么条件
华为应用市场是华为手机用户下载应用程序的主要来源之一,如果你开发了一款应用并想要在华为应用市场上架,需要满足以下条件:1. 应用符合法律法规要求:应用不得含有违反法律法规的内容,例如色情、暴力、赌博等内容。2. 应用具有独特性:应用需要有独特的功能或者创新
2023-04-17
app上架审核需要多久
在移动应用市场中,每个应用都需要经过审核才能上架。审核的目的是确保应用程序的质量和安全性,以保护用户的利益。但是,审核的时间可能会因各种因素而有所不同,本文将详细介绍审核的原理和可能影响审核时间的因素。首先,审核时间取决于应用提交的市场和应用商店的审核政策
2023-04-17